Output 2ef4c4e494ed7ae5cb0b25f72ac3637a0e39d95d177162cee17338c5662cdea1:6

value
339902671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a24af646dd3a51f32b8c88f206427bb9d6bb2d0 OP_EQUAL
address
38T3sfcDTNun9JWeXpjMgRFPX6SP6KHUu8
transaction
2ef4c4e494ed7ae5cb0b25f72ac3637a0e39d95d177162cee17338c5662cdea1
spent
true